Each vessel, its tackle, apparel, and furniture and the owner of the vessel are jointly and severally liable for the compensation of a pilot employed on the vessel and the pilot has a lien on the vessel, the vessel's tackle, apparel, and furniture for the pilot's compensation.
AS 08.62.170
Pilot's lien for compensation
